In the japan pavilion inside the department store there in an area where you pick an oyster and they open it up and pull the pearl out for you. I find it quite addicting and love pearls myself.

They have the same thing at downtown disney but I've had terrible service there a few times, and I think it is a few other places-the beach club resort by the pool and maybe a water park (I've never been to the waterparks so I'm not 100% sure)

Seaworld and universal city walk also have booths, but none are as fun as at Japan. :)

The Pick a Pearl (or Pearl Factory) locations at the Boardwalk, Downtown Disney and the water parks are different than the one in the Japan Pavilion. The Pearl Factory is a Hawaii based company and they have locations in California, Nevada and Florida as well as Hawaii of course.

Just two weeks ago I watched some of the pearls being picked in Japan and I found them to be smaller than the ones at the Pearl Factory. I should say that I own about 10-15 pieces of pearl jewelry all being "picked" from the Pearl Factory. The Pearl Factory is more expensive than those in Japan and they probably offer a higher quality selection of jewelry. (Diamond / gemstone / gold settings).

From the Pearl Factory I have picked blue, silver, black and white pearls. All of various sizes.
